介绍
计算器是前端开发中常用的工具之一,它可以帮助我们准确地计算各种数据。而在实际开发中,有时需要计算两个数的差值,这时就需要用到一个 npm 包,叫做 calculator-differences。
calculator-differences 是一个轻量级的 npm 包,可以方便地计算两个数的差值,并且支持多种小数精度,非常适合用于前端开发中的差值计算。
安装
在使用 calculator-differences 前,需要先在项目中安装该 npm 包。可以使用以下命令进行安装:
npm install calculator-differences --save
使用
使用 calculator-differences 也非常简单,只需要引入该 npm 包并调用其函数即可。
const calcDifference = require('calculator-differences'); const num1 = 10; const num2 = 3; console.log(calcDifference(num1, num2)); // 7
上述代码中,我们首先引入了 calculator-differences,然后调用 calcDifference 函数计算了 num1 和 num2 两个数的差值。最后输出结果为 7。
calculator-differences 还支持多种小数精度。例如,如果要保留 2 位小数,则可以传入第三个参数:
const calcDifference = require('calculator-differences'); const num1 = 10.12345; const num2 = 3.21; console.log(calcDifference(num1, num2, 2)); // 6.91
上述代码中,我们将 num1 和 num2 的差值保留了 2 位小数,输出结果为 6.91。
进一步扩展
除了计算两个数的差值外,calculator-differences 还支持其它一些有用的计算功能。例如,如果要计算 num1 和 num2 两个数中较大的数,则可以使用 calcMax 函数:
const calcMax = require('calculator-differences').calcMax; const num1 = 10; const num2 = 3; console.log(calcMax(num1, num2)); // 10
上述代码中,我们使用了 calcMax 函数,输出结果为 num1。
如果要计算 num1 和 num2 两个数中较小的数,则可以使用 calcMin 函数:
const calcMin = require('calculator-differences').calcMin; const num1 = 10; const num2 = 3; console.log(calcMin(num1, num2)); // 3
上述代码中,我们使用了 calcMin 函数,输出结果为 num2。
除了上述函数之外,calculator-differences 还支持很多其它的计算功能。如果想了解更多细节信息,可以查看 npm 上该包的文档。
总结
通过本篇文章,我们学习了如何使用 calculator-differences 这个npm包来计算差值,并实现了一些常用的计算功能,比如求较大值和较小值等。希望本文能够给前端工程师带来一些指导和帮助。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/6005539281e8991b448d0c3c